Bolt.new
Pros
- Rapidly create full-stack applications from plain English prompts in minutes instead of weeks
- No local development environment required; everything runs in the browser and cloud
- Supports multiple JavaScript frameworks like React and Vue without vendor lock-in
- One-click deployment with automatic SSL and CDN makes publishing instantaneous
- Built-in databases and authentication eliminate separate backend provisioning work
- Multi-agent model switching improves code accuracy and cross-file consistency
Cons
- Debugging complex multi-service logic can be limited compared to manual tooling
- Generated UI designs can constrain highly custom or experimental interface creativity
- Potential vendor lock-in concerns with built-in hosting and proprietary project formats

Bolt.new Features
- AI-Powered Vibe Coding Agent to build full-stack apps through natural chat prompts
- Built-in cloud hosting with custom domains, SSL certificates, and SEO optimization
- Unlimited built-in databases with user authentication, edge functions, and file storage
- Multi-agent model switching between Claude Opus, Sonnet, and Haiku directly in interface
- MCP server connectors to integrate Notion, GitHub, Linear, and external data sources
- One-click deployment with automatic security scans and built-in web analytics dashboard
- Figma import and AI image generation for seamless design-to-developer handoff
- Real-time function testing and hot-reload simulation inside the browser editor
- Direct GitHub sync, branch management, and OAuth-based version control integration
